Complete Buying Guide for Best Paint Markers for Plastic
Essential Factors We Consider
When selecting the best paint markers for plastic, we evaluate ink type (acrylic vs. oil-based), tip design, color vibrancy, drying time, adhesion strength, and ease of use. Acrylic markers are ideal for most crafters due to their water-based safety and versatility, while oil-based options offer superior permanence. Dual-tip designs provide flexibility, and cotton nibs eliminate messy priming. Always look for waterproof, fade-resistant formulas that bond well to smooth, non-porous surfaces.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Will paint markers work on all types of plastic?
A: Most high-quality acrylic or oil-based paint markers adhere well to common plastics like PET, PVC, and polycarbonate. For extremely glossy or flexible plastics, lightly sanding the surface can improve adhesion.
Q: Do I need to seal paint marker designs on plastic?
A: Water-based acrylic markers may benefit from a clear sealant for long-term durability, especially if the item will be washed or exposed to moisture. Oil-based markers typically don’t require sealing.
Q: Can paint markers be used on children’s toys?
A: Yes, as long as the markers are labeled non-toxic and safe for kids. Always allow paint to dry completely before handing items back to children.
Q: How do I prevent paint markers from drying out?
A: Store them horizontally, replace caps tightly after use, and avoid leaving tips exposed to air for extended periods.
Q: Are dual-tip markers better than single-tip?
A: Dual-tip markers offer greater versatility—fine tips for details and broad tips for filling—making them ideal for most crafting and DIY projects involving plastic.
